How Common Is The Last Name Apiag? popularity and diffusion
This surname is the 147,599th most widely held last name at a global level It is held by approximately 1 in 2,429,992 people. The surname is mostly found in Asia, where 98 percent of Apiag reside; 98 percent reside in Southeast Asia and 96 percent reside in Fil-Southeast Asia.
Apiag is most commonly held in The Philippines, where it is held by 2,924 people, or 1 in 34,623. In The Philippines Apiag is most numerous in: Zamboanga Peninsula, where 24 percent reside, Northern Mindanao, where 23 percent reside and Central Visayas, where 12 percent reside. Besides The Philippines Apiag occurs in 7 countries. It also occurs in Guam, where 1 percent reside and The United States, where 1 percent reside.
